portfolio: 0.71.2 -> 0.72.2 (#360387)
[NixPkgs.git] / pkgs / applications / system / coolercontrol / coolercontrol-ui-data.nix
blob6906769b44ad798798c8aa599ee930a50782759c
1 { buildNpmPackage, autoPatchelfHook }:
4   version,
5   src,
6   meta,
7 }:
9 buildNpmPackage {
10   pname = "coolercontrol-ui";
11   inherit version src;
12   sourceRoot = "${src.name}/coolercontrol-ui";
14   npmDepsHash = "sha256-j+bGOGIG9H/1z0dN8BfvWSi6gPvYmCV7l0ZNH8h3yeU=";
16   preBuild = ''
17     autoPatchelf node_modules/sass-embedded-linux-x64/dart-sass/src/dart
18   '';
20   nativeBuildInputs = [ autoPatchelfHook ];
22   dontAutoPatchelf = true;
24   postBuild = ''
25     cp -r dist $out
26   '';
28   dontInstall = true;
30   meta = meta // {
31     description = "${meta.description} (UI data)";
32   };